Yobtar; load a different game system and create a blank roster then go to the "Develop" menu and uncheck "Enable Data File Debugging" to prevent those errors. You only really need to see that stuff if you are actually editing the files themselves.
As for the files as they are: Chaos Warhounds are able to satisfy the Core requirements on their own in both the Beastman and Chaos Warrior lists; this should not be possible as they do not count towards the minimum core requirement. Also, the "minimum three units" composition rule doesn't seem to be implemented in any of the armies I've tried; I was able to create a "valid" army consisting of a general and a single giant core unit when the minimum should be three units (core, special or rare) and a general.
